CAR T therapy in adult DLBCL patients in Slovenia : evaluation of predictive scores for outcomes and adverse eventsLucija Sršen, Irena Auersperger, Larisa Janžič, Andreja Nataša Kopitar, Katarina Reberšek, Barbara Jezeršek Novaković, Polona Novak, Karla Rener, Klara Šlajpah, Alojz Ihan, Samo Zver, Matjaž Sever, 2026, original scientific article Abstract: CAR T cell therapy is a promising immunotherapy for hematologic malignancies, yet early prediction of outcomes and adverse events remains difficult, especially in small real-world cohorts. We retrospectively analyzed 14 adult patients with diffuse large B-cell lymphoma (DLBCL) treated with CAR T cells in Slovenia, assessing IL-6 increase rates and established predictive metrics including EASIX-C, CAR-HEMATOTOX, and IBPS on Day -5 (pre-lymphodepletion) and Day 0 (infusion). Contrary to our expectation, an inverse correlation was observed between the increase rate of IL-6 and the occurrence of severe cytopenias, indicating higher IL-6 increase rate leads to less severe cytopenias. The EASIX-C score showed higher predictive values when calculated on Day 0, contrary to the CAR-HEMATOTOX score, whose higher predictive values were observed on Day -5. The IBPS predictive values showed mixed results when comparing Day -5 to Day 0. We observed 50% response rate and 29% remission rate. The results highlight the utility of predictive scores, with unexpected findings on IL-6 suggesting further study is necessary. Safety, long-term effectiveness, and immunogenicity of varicella vaccination in children with juvenile idiopathic arthritis treated with biologic therapyMaša Bizjak, Jakob Peterlin, Tadej Avčin, Miroslav Petrovec, Alojz Ihan, Mojca Zajc Avramovič, Gašper Markelj, Tina Vesel, Veronika Osterman, Jerneja Ahčan, Helena Mole, Katja Dejak Gornik, Alenka Biteznik, Sara Jevnikar, Larisa Janžič, Miha Bajc, Andreja Nataša Kopitar, Nataša Toplak, 2025, original scientific article Abstract: Objective: To evaluate safety, long-term effectiveness and immunogenicity of varicella vaccination in children with JIA, treated with biologic disease-modifying antirheumatic drugs (bDMARDs). Methods: This is a prospective case-control study. VZV-naive patients with JIA on selected bDMARDs (TNFi, IL-6 and IL-1 inhibitors), who were at risk for contracting varicella, had stable disease and normal values of immunoglobulins and lymphocyte populations, were vaccinated against varicella. Adverse events (AEs) and disease activity were followed after vaccination. VZV-specific humoral (VZV-IgG) and cell-mediated immunity (VZV-CMI) were measured at predetermined time points after vaccination by Liaison and intracellular cytokine staining, respectively. Two healthy control (HC) groups comprised 52 healthy children after varicella vaccination and 69 healthy children after varicella infection. Results: 17 patients were vaccinated against varicella (12 on TNFi, 4 on IL-6 inhibitors and 1 on IL-1 inhibitor), of whom 14 patients received both the first and second dose on bDMARDs. No vaccine-strain infections or other serious AEs occurred after vaccination. Disease activity increased in 3/17 (18 %) patients following vaccination. Four out of 17 (24 %) patients developed mild breakthrough varicella (BV) 4 months-4.5 years after vaccination, and none of the HC. Fourteen out of 17 (82 %) patients and 50/52 (96 %) vaccinated HC were seropositive after second vaccination and 8/11 (72 %) patients and 42/43 (98 %) vaccinated HC developed VZV-CMI, which persisted longer compared to VZV-IgG. Patients presented lower antibody levels compared to HC. The rate of VZV-IgG decline was comparable between patients and HC after vaccination or infection. Five patients received the third vaccine dose due to primary or secondary vaccine failure, and none of them developed BV. Conclusions: Varicella vaccination was safe and largely immunogenic in our cohort of JIA patients treated with bDMARDs. Although the vaccination was not always fully effective, it prevented severe disease in all vaccinated patients. PARP inhibitor olaparib has a potential to increase the effectiveness of electrochemotherapy in BRCA1 mutated breast cancer in miceMaša Omerzel, Tanja Jesenko, Boštjan Markelc, Larisa Janžič, Maja Čemažar, Gregor Serša, 2021, original scientific article Abstract: Electrochemotherapy (ECT), a local therapy, has different effectiveness among tumor types. In breast can-cer, its effectiveness is low; therefore, combined therapies are needed. The aim of our study was to com-bine ECT with PARP inhibitor olaparib, which could inhibit the repair of bleomycin or cisplatin inducedDNA damage and potentiate the effectiveness of ECT. The effects of combined therapy were studied inBRCA1mutated (HCC1937) and non-mutated (HCC1143) triple negative breast cancer cell lines.Therapeutic effectiveness was studied in 2D and 3D cell cultures andin vivoon subcutaneousHCC1937 tumor model in mice. The underlying mechanism of combined therapy was determined withthe evaluation ofcH2AX foci. Combined therapy of ECT with bleomycin and olaparib potentiated theeffectiveness of ECT inBRCA1mutated HCC1937, but not in non-mutated HCC1143 cells. The combinedtherapy had a synergistic effect, which was due to the increased number of DNA double strand breaks.Addition of olaparib to ECT with bleomycinin vivoin HCC1937 tumor model had only minimal effect,indicating repetitive olaparib treatment would be needed. This study demonstrates that DNA repar inhibiting drugs, like olaparib, have the potential to increase the effectiveness of ECT with bleomycin.
